Welcome

University Archives & Manuscripts supports the teaching, research and public service missions of the University Libraries by collecting, preserving, organizing, and making accessible the often unique or rare materials that document the history of our university and the Piedmont Triad region. We also house the Betty H. Carter Women Veterans Historical Project.

As part of our commitment to archival outreach, we deliver presentations and teach classes; lead campus tours; construct on-site and online exhibits; conduct oral history interviews; and assist students, faculty, staff and the general public with research questions relating to our collections.

Timeline of UNCG History Launches

University History TimelineThe University Archives is proud to announce the completion of a timeline which chronicles the history of The University of North Carolina at Greensboro from its founding in 1891 to the present day. The Timeline of UNCG History includes interesting facts, archival photographs, and other related media documenting significant events in the University's development. As an ongoing project, the Timeline will continue to expand and include new media and facts. If you have any questions, please contact University Archives staff.
